L&T Mindtree IT Office in New Town Boosts Bengal Tech
KT- Suvendu Adhikari

L&T Mindtree IT Office in New Town has marked a significant development for West Bengal’s technology and investment landscape. Chief Minister Shri Suvendu Adhikari inaugurated the state-of-the-art information technology office in New Town, highlighting the growing importance of the region as a destination for technology-driven businesses and infrastructure.

Spread across more than 7 lakh square feet, the newly inaugurated facility represents a major addition to New Town’s expanding IT ecosystem. The development is expected to strengthen the state’s technology infrastructure while opening up new possibilities for investment, employment and professional opportunities.

Major Boost for West Bengal’s Technology Sector

The inauguration of the L&T Mindtree IT Office in New Town comes at a time when West Bengal is seeking to strengthen its position as a hub for information technology, digital services and innovation.

The large-scale facility is expected to contribute to the development of a stronger technology ecosystem in New Town. With modern infrastructure and significant operational space, the office can provide a platform for expanding technology-related activities and supporting a wider network of professionals and businesses.

The project also underlines the importance of private-sector participation in developing Bengal’s technology infrastructure. Large technology facilities can generate demand for a range of services while contributing to the growth of associated sectors.

New Town’s Growing IT Infrastructure

New Town has emerged as one of the key areas for commercial and technology-related development in West Bengal. The arrival of large-scale IT infrastructure further strengthens the locality’s role in the state’s evolving business landscape.

The L&T Mindtree IT Office in New Town adds another major technology facility to the area and could help attract further investments from companies looking for modern office infrastructure and access to skilled professionals.

A stronger concentration of technology companies can also encourage the development of supporting infrastructure, including business services, transport, hospitality, retail and other sectors connected with the corporate ecosystem.

Employment Opportunities in Focus

One of the major potential benefits of the project is its contribution to employment opportunities in West Bengal’s technology sector.

Large IT facilities require professionals across multiple disciplines, ranging from software development and engineering to project management, business operations, administration and other specialised functions.

The expansion of technology infrastructure can therefore create opportunities not only within individual companies but also across the wider ecosystem supporting the IT industry.

For young professionals and skilled workers in Bengal, the growth of large technology offices could provide greater access to employment opportunities closer to home.
